Объявление форума |
Если пользуетесь личными сообщениями и получили по электронной почте оповещение о новом письме, не отвечайте, пожалуйста, почтой. Зайдите на форум и ответьте отправителю через ЛС. |
Полигон-2 » IBM PC-совместимое. До 2000 года включительно » Ковокс в качестве... вольтметра |
<<Назад Вперед>> | Страницы: 1 * 2 | Печать |
EJSanYo
Advanced Member
Всего сообщений: 318 Рейтинг пользователя: 0 Ссылка Дата регистрации на форуме: 28 дек. 2007 |
doctorgenius, оригинальная идея! :au: Типа реализация АЦП с и спользованием ЦАП-а вместо интегратора. И прогу аналогичного назначения в чём угодно накатать можно. Хоть в бейсике, хоть в Си. Тока как я понимаю, лучше вместо ковокса было бы какой-нить нормальный ЦАПик повесить, или как оно. (Сообщение отредактировал EJSanYo 12 янв. 2008 1:42) |
doctorgenius
Junior Member
Откуда: Днепропетровск Всего сообщений: 147 Рейтинг пользователя: 0 Ссылка Дата регистрации на форуме: 3 фев. 2006 |
прогу - да, действительно. Просто был под рукой Turbo Pascal 7.1 в нем и делал. Компилировуется так "как есть", работает из под DOS. А микрухи подходящей быстро найти не удалось. Потому в "образовательных целях" собирал из того что под рукой было. (Сообщение отредактировал doctorgenius 12 янв. 2008 0:23) |
KateMargo
Newbie
Откуда: Днепропетровск Всего сообщений: 1 Рейтинг пользователя: 0 Ссылка Дата регистрации на форуме: 12 янв. 2008 |
хм...очень заинтересовала идея doctorgenius. вы молодцы. Знающего человека сразу видно. совет вам на "ноу-хау"))) |
Alexey
Advanced Member
Пользователь Всего сообщений: 570 Рейтинг пользователя: 0 Ссылка Дата регистрации на форуме: 11 дек. 2002 |
Тогда уж, если не делать АЦП на отдельной микросхеме (что предпочтительнее), то можно оптимизировать алгоритм (вместо перебора 256 значений сделать около 8) и получить подобие осциллографа. |
Baza
Advanced Member
Откуда: С-Петербург Всего сообщений: 615 Рейтинг пользователя: 0 Ссылка Дата регистрации на форуме: 13 мая 2005 |
В инете пробегали схемы и софт для АЦП с 8-бит параллельным интерфейсом, которые вешались тупо на LPT и получался осцилл и вольтметр. |
Geners |
NEW! Сообщение отправлено: 12 января 2008 15:03
Baza и я про тоже .... лисапед однако .... |
Сейчас на форуме |
EJSanYo
Advanced Member
Всего сообщений: 318 Рейтинг пользователя: 0 Ссылка Дата регистрации на форуме: 28 дек. 2007 |
Я как-то и 16-битный АЦП вешал - работало в EPP-режиме между прочим! На QBasic-е некое подобие осциллографа накатал, дальше всё забросил. Мда, всё-таки я лентяй.. (Сообщение отредактировал EJSanYo 13 янв. 2008 1:43) |
EJSanYo
Advanced Member
Всего сообщений: 318 Рейтинг пользователя: 0 Ссылка Дата регистрации на форуме: 28 дек. 2007 |
Кстати, а ежели использовать ECP для ввода/вывода сигналов? При таком обмене можно было ли бы ускорить работы схемы? (Сообщение отредактировал EJSanYo 13 янв. 2008 1:41) |
doctorgenius
Junior Member
Откуда: Днепропетровск Всего сообщений: 147 Рейтинг пользователя: 0 Ссылка Дата регистрации на форуме: 3 фев. 2006 |
из порта 378 (порт ВЫВОДА), мы выводим данные на ЦАП: перебираем значения от 0 до FF hex таким образом формировуем на инверсном входе ОУ пилообразный сигнал (см. выше). На неинвертирующий вход ОУ подаем измеряемое напряжение (0-5В). При совпадении напряжений на входах ОУ, компаратор выдаст лог. 0 в порт 379. отслеживаем это событие и запоминаем при каком значении напряжения сравнялись. Далее без особых проблем вычисляем, чему равно измеряемое напряжение: Uизм=([ЗП378]/(2^8)/5)) где [ЗП378] - то значение, при записи которого в порт 378, компаратор изменил состояние порта 379 (порт ВВОДА). 2^8 - поскольку у нас 8 бит. 5 - 5В (диапазон 0-5В). и выводим его на экран. Именно по этой причине в данном случае, использовать режим ECP нет необходимости. |
0leg
Advanced Member
Откуда: Город-герой Тула Всего сообщений: 1991 Рейтинг пользователя: 0 Ссылка Дата регистрации на форуме: 6 окт. 2007 |
> Именно по этой причине в данном случае, использовать > режим ECP нет необходимости. В данном случае да, действительно нафиг EEP/ECP не нужен. А если нормальный АЦП поставить? На какой-нибудь микрухе? Чтобы сразу все биты результата выдавал. Так и осциллограф можно сделать, причём достаточно шустрый. И как правильно Alexey сказал, за _восемь_ шагов (при правильном подходе к делу!) можно получить результат измерения. А вовсе не за 255. |
<<Назад Вперед>> | Страницы: 1 * 2 | Печать |
Полигон-2 » IBM PC-совместимое. До 2000 года включительно » Ковокс в качестве... вольтметра |
1 посетитель просмотрел эту тему за последние 15 минут |
В том числе: 1 гость, 0 скрытых пользователей |
Последние | |
[Москва] LIQUID-Акция. Сливаются разъемы CF МС7004 и 7004А на AT и XT Пайка термотрубок Проммать s478 PEAK 715VL2-HT ( Full-Size SBC) Подскажите по 386 материке по джамперам. |
Самые активные 5 тем | |